According to the researchers, they turn the conclusion that the changes are in line with the starting of fire use and eating cooked food sooner of raw food (Organ, Nunn, Machanda and Wrangham 14559). The article findings and explanations are in line with the discussions made by Stanford in his guard Exploring biological anthropology the essentials where the discussion on hominids is based mainly on their anatomical changes and their significance during that conviction in the phylogeny of the hominids from Australopithecus to Homo sapiens. Stanford specifically discusses the anatomical changes and how the carcass bipedal plans of the earlier hominids are how they were suitable to the environment (Stanford, Allen and Anton 239). The same discussion is made later on in the book but this time the focus is on the genus Homo (Homo erectus, Homo neanderthalensis and Homo sapiens) and how they were more evolved towards becoming more like the confront humans (Stanford, Allen and Anton 277). Even though both chapters discuss different hominids, the anatomical changes according to the period in history and the environment all add up and present a detailed and flowing phylogeny of these hominids.
